MORE INFO ON THE ALL-TIME SERIES
- Monmouth and Sacred Heart are meeting for the 35th time in women's basketball competition.
- Sacred Heart leads the all-time series, 20-14.
- Sacred Heart won last season's meeting, 59-50, in West Long Branch on Nov. 15, 2023.
- The road team has won each of the past four times.
- The former NEC rivals have met three times in a season thrice (two regular season matchups + postseason).
